    • There were quite a few Huits married in South Pool in the 1680s and 1690s, suggesting the family was established in the parish. However, the PRs only go back to 1664/5 so finding anything earlier will be difficult. The BTs may help.

      The same is not true of the Nicholls family. The only entries from the start of the PRs to 1733 are for John and his immediate family (i.e. wife and children). In 1734 a Roger can be found having children.

      It looks, therefore, like John might well have moved to South Pool from elsewhere, but I think his name is too common for any realistic possibility of identifying him, should his baptism be in any PRs that do survive.
